NAVY DIVING: After leading the competition through the preliminary session, Navy's Olaf Olson fell to fourth place in the final 3-meter springboard standings at the NCAA Zone A Diving Championship in Buffalo, N.Y. Olson posted a score of 370.65 points after the opening six rounds of diving to lead second-place Alex Volovetski from Pittsburgh by 11 points. His lead quickly vanished after his initial dive of the finals, however, as Olson scored just 37.80 points on a forward three-and-one-half somersault tuck.
